The population in Waubeka is 581. There are 247 people per square mile aka population density. The median age in Waubeka is 37.8, the US median age is 38.4. The number of people per household in Waubeka is 3.0, the US average of people per household is 2.6.
Family in Waubeka
- 64.0% are married
- 6.2% are divorced
- 46.3% are married with children
- 12.8% have children, but are single
Race in Waubeka
- 97.6% are White
- 0.0% are Black
- 0.0% are Asian
- 0.0% are Native American
- 0.0% claim Other
- 2.4% claim Hispanic ethnicity
- 0.0% Two or more races
- 0.0% Hawaiian, Pacific Islander
